Mga computerProgramming

Makinis na mga transition ng kulay: CSS gradient

Natural na kulay ay karaniwang pantay makinis. Ngunit kahit na sa isang ganap na patag na ibabaw ng isang solid na kulay na imahe ng natural na mga transition ng kulay. Laging sinasadyang mahulog sa sikat ng araw o artipisyal na ilaw, pati na rin ang pagbabago sa anggulo ng view nagbibigay-daan sa hindi regular at natatanging mga kakulay.

Dalawang puntos ng view na naglalayong sa parehong bagay, maramdaman ang kulay pagkakaiba, ayon sa pagkakabanggit, ng kanilang mga anggulo pananaw at ugnayan sa iba pang mga anggulo ng saklaw ng sinag sa ibabaw ng pabalik-balik.

Sikolohikal na mga epekto ng transition ng kulay

Kulay ay hindi lamang ang pisikal sensations at nakasalalay hindi lamang sa ang oras at posisyon sa espasyo. Imahe ng mga puno, gusali, bundok at iba pang mga item sa isang inverted posisyon pukawin ang pakiramdam ng salamin sa ibabaw ng tubig o sa kabilang surface.

Hinding black parallel na linya sa isang perpektong puting ibabaw pader, ang bawat linya sa ibabaw ng buong haba pagtaas sa proporsyon sa ang kapal ng pagbabawas ng natural na kapal ng linya kapag tiningnan sa isang pader - ang lahat ng ito ay magiging sanhi ng isang pang-amoy sa viewer na ang kuwarto ay may pahalang na kisame.

Isang larawan ay inscribed sa dalawa, at bawat isa sa kanila ay Paglipat na may paggalang sa bawat isa sa pamamagitan ng isang distansya sa pagitan ng mga mata, na nagbibigay sa ang epekto ng spatial volume, kung defocus hitsura.

Kung ang poster ay malaki sapat at ang pagtawid sa hangganan sa katotohanan na ginawa perpekto, ang larawan sa poster ay makikita bilang natural na ang nais na lilim ng kulay, ang kamalayan ng beholder ay awtomatikong kumonekta.

Site, at higit sa lahat, ang disenyo at scheme ng kulay ay mahalaga at komplimentaryong mapagkukunan na lohika, ang kanyang dialogue, gumawa ng tamang sikolohikal na epekto sa mga bisita.

Makinis na mga transition sa pamamagitan ng CSS

Gradients ay nilikha na may guhit-gradient () at radial-gradient (). Sa unang kaso, ang isang makinis na pagbabago ng kulay ay nangyayari sa kahabaan ng linya at sa pangalawang kaso - ng isang tambilugan o bilog. CSS gradient ay maaaring itakda sa ang mga katangian ng background, background-image, hangganan-larawan, listahan-style-image. Superimposing mga elemento sa bawat isa, pagtukoy ng kanilang transparency makakabuo ng mahusay na kulay at lumikha ng mga natatanging mga transition.

Ito ay dapat gayunpaman ay makitid ang isip sa isip na ang kulay transition ay hindi maaaring palaging magiging makinis. Ang ilang mga variant ng mga kumbinasyon ng kulay, ang mga halaga ng transparency, pahina layout background ay maaaring magbigay sa hindi kanais-nais na hakbang effects.

mga panuntunan CSS para sa pag-record ng background gradient

gradient ay isang maayos na paglipat mula sa isang kulay sa isa pa. Sa kasong ito, maaari mong gamitin ang maramihang mga kulay. Tandaan ang mga linear na bersyon ng (CSS linear gradient) ay maaaring iba-iba:

Ang unang parameter ay ang pagkahilig anggulo side o rehiyon, na sinusundan ng kulay. Hindi kinakailangan upang gamitin lamang ng dalawang kulay, maaari kang gumuhit sa buong bahaghari. Paglalapat ng transparency opacity ng ari-arian ay maaaring makuha o-overlap na epekto.

Ang pagpili ng mga kulay, ang kulay generators

Ang creative bahagi ng taga-disenyo, site ng nag-develop sa mga nakaraang taon pinasimple. Nagiging praktikal at angkop na hugis-parihaba hugis, na naglalaman ng isang minimum ng impormasyon, ang isang minimum na ng mga pag-andar, ang maximum na kahulugan at kaisipan saloobin na ibenta ang produkto, magbigay ng serbisyo, i-highlight diskwento, kalidad at / o mga makabuluhang pagkakaiba mula sa mga kakumpitensya.

Gayunpaman, kahit na sa tulad mahirap mga kondisyon, regulasyon at ang paglikha ng mga modernong web-resource ay isang lugar para pagkamalikhain at isang malinaw na pagnanais ng ilang mga developer upang gumawa ng isang agresibo, naka-target na trabaho na may kulay, na sumasalamin sa ang kahulugan ng ang nilalaman ng teksto at ang estilo pinili dialogue. CSS gradient ay na-apply nang mas madalas.

solusyon Kulay ng "Google" at "Skype ni", sa partikular, ay nagkaroon ng isang epekto at ang mga tagasunod, gayunpaman, sa huling ilang taon, ang aktibong bahagi ng disenyo ng web ay nagsimulang upang tumingin para sa mga bagong hugis, bagong mga kulay at hindi mapanghimasok, subukan ang mga dynamics ng tuluy-tuloy na mga form.

Sa Internet maraming mga online na mapagkukunan (CSS gradient generator), na lubos na pinapasimple ang trabaho ng pagpili ng tamang kulay :. Angrytools, flatonika, generatecass atbp Sa kanilang tulong, maaari mo ba talagang i-save ng oras sa pagpili ng tamang kulay, isaalang-alang ang linya transition at mga overlay.

Dynamic na scheme ng kulay

Tradition, kalakip ang paglikha ng mga web-mapagkukunan, na ginawa malalabag panuntunan: ang istraktura, nilalaman at dialogue na site na may mga customer - ang kakayahan ng nag-develop ipinapatupad ang kalooban ng may-ari (customer). Hitsura ng site, nito disenyo ay din ayon sa kaugalian ay tumutukoy sa ang katunayan na ito ay hindi natukoy sa pamamagitan ng client.

Samantala, isang iba't ibang mga aparato ay lumalaki, at sa mga pamilya ng bawat uri ay may iba't-ibang mga promising specimens, na may mga makabuluhang pagkakaiba, hindi lamang sa kulay pagpaparami, tulad ng sa ang resolution at browser bumubuo sa nakikitang rehiyon.

Ang iba't-ibang mga browser at mga bersyon ginagamit din lumilikha ng mga problema sa isang sapat na pagma-map ng CSS gradient kakayahan.

Sama-sama sa pagsusuri ng mga pangyayari, at mga halimbawa ng ilang mga promising trabaho, maaari itong Nagtalo na ang hitsura ng site lamang defaultnom estado - ang kakayanan ng mga developer at / o may-ari ng mapagkukunan. Lamang kapag ang isang customer ay unang bumisita sa resource, maaaring ito ay magagawang upang suriin ang disenyo ng site. Kung ang customer ay nakakita akma upang tandaan ang mga site at gamitin ito sa kanilang araw araw na buhay, kanyang pagnanais na magkaroon ng mga tool upang kontrolin ang hitsura at pag-andar ay ganap na nabigyang-katarungan.

Tulad ng isang sentro ng grabidad sa mga benepisyo developer transfer: Hindi na kailangan upang makisali sa pagpapatupad ng cross-browser compatibility, test site sa iba't ibang mga aparato sa iba't-ibang mga operating system.

Dagdag pa rito, ang trend ay bubuo ng isang karaniwang database para sa aktwal na pagpapatupad ng CSS panuntunan sa iba't ibang mga aparato. Ito ay lamang sa simula, ngunit ang potensyal nito ay ng malaking kahalagahan.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 tl.delachieve.com. Theme powered by WordPress.